GAY SAIGON

 Largest city of Vietnam Ho Chi Minh City (HCMC) is also considered as the economic capital. Large avenues, parks, and French colonial buildings are some reasons why the city was called the Paris in the Orient. The tourist attractions are the City Hall, the Municipal Theatre, Notre-Dame Cathedral, the Main Post Office..

GAY HANOI

 Capital and second largest city of Vietnam, Hanoi is located in North of the country. The 1000 years of the establishment of the city were celebrated in October 2010. From this long period when Vietnamese dynasties were ruling the country, the city still has many interesting cultural and historic monuments.
For the visitors, several places should not be missed, such as Temple of Literature, One Pillar Pagoda, Flag Tower of Hanoi... And from the French colonial period : the Grand Opera House, State Bank of Vietnam (formerly The Bank of Indochina), Presidential Palace (formerly Palace of the Governor-General of French Indochina), Saint Joseph Cathedral, and the historic Hotel Metropole.
